Ivan T. Bowman is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Information Systems and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, Ivan T. Bowman has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 342 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Computer Networks and Communications, 12 papers in Information Systems and 10 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in Ivan T. Bowman's work include Advanced Database Systems and Queries (12 papers), Data Management and Algorithms (6 papers) and Advanced Software Engineering Methodologies (5 papers). Ivan T. Bowman is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Database Systems and Queries (12 papers), Data Management and Algorithms (6 papers) and Advanced Software Engineering Methodologies (5 papers). Ivan T. Bowman coll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United Kingdom and United States. Ivan T. Bowman's co-authors include Richard C. Holt, Kenneth Salem, Michael W. Godfrey, Anisoara Nica, David Toman, David DeHaan, Brendan Lucier, Güneş Aluç and Nandan Marathe and has published in prestigious journals such as ACM Transactions on Database Systems, Information and Software Technology and Data & Knowledge Engineering.
